WebAction plan . Your action plan sums up anything you need to do in order to improve things for next time. Do you perhaps need to learn about something or attend some training? Could you ask your tutor ... Use Gibbs’ model, and structure your assignment using Gibbs’ headings. Description . WebNov 30, 2024 · Action Plan definition. An Action Plan or Action Programme is a detailed plan with specified actions that are needed to achieve a goal. It can also consist of a series of steps that must be taken to successfully complete a certain strategy. Furthermore, an action programme determines which resources are required to achieve ( SMART Goals) …
